If you have financial problems in your life, it is important to notify your credit card issuer. If you’re likely to miss a payment, by contacting the company that issued your credit card, you might be able to work out some sort of adjusted payment plan. This can help make them not turn in a report to a reporting late payments to the major credit bureaus.

Have a list you keep of all your credit card accounts by number as well as the lender’s emergency phone numbers. Keep this list in a safe place, such as a safety deposit box, away from each of your credit cards. The list is useful as a way to quickly contact lenders in case of a lost or if they are stolen.

Check with your credit card company about their willingness to reduce your interest rates. There are a few companies that will lower an interest rate if they know and trust the customer due to working with them for a long period of time. It could save you a lot of money and there is no cost to asking for it.

Educate yourself on recent laws affecting consumers using credit cards. For example, companies cannot give retroactive rate hikes. They are also not allowed to engage in double-cycle billing.
